Проблема власних функцій та власних значень у теорії нерівноважних процесів у конденсованому бозе-газі

Abstract

У роботі досліджено задачу на власні функції та власні значення оператора лінеаризованого інтеграла зіткнень квантового кінетичного рівняння Больцмана для моделі слабконеідеального бозе-газу за наявності в ньому бозе-конденсату. Побудовано перші вісім ортогоналізованих та нормованих власних функцій і розраховано відповідні власні значення. Показано, що перші три власні значення дорівнюють нулю. Розглянуто можливості застосування системи власних функцій опертора лінеаризованого інтеграла зіткнень для теоретичного опису слабконерівноважних процесів у бозе-газі за наявності конденсату, зокрема для опису звукових хвиль, розрахунку кінетичних коефіцієнтів в’язкості та теплопровідності тощо. In this paper we study the problem of eigenfunctions and eigenvalues for the linear collision operator of quantum kinetic Boltzmann equation. We calculated the first eight eigenfunctions and constructed their linear combinations, which allows through successive approximations to investigate the propagation of sound waves, to describe the effects of attenuation and to calculate transport coefficients (viscosity, thermal conductivity). Given the structure of the collision integral first three eigenvalues is zero. This is due to the existence of the laws of conservation of the number of particles, momentum and energy, which are performed in collisions of particles. The following eigenvalues are not equal to zero and are negative.
